actually. if you get tivo directly from the states it WONT work.

1) Tivo by default accepts NTSC input while we use PAL
2) When you first get tivo you need to go through the setup which will require you to dial the tivo service number. This wont work cuz you are in Kuwait not in the states.
3) Even if you solve the above 2 issues, tivo is pretty useless without the guide.

BUT there is a solution but you need to be good with electronics and coding.. which i am not but a very smart friend of mine is.

He setup our tivos to get the showtime tv guide, work with our PAL system, work with our HUmax receivers and make everything automated so that once you set it up you never have to do anything again. Its not easy, he spent a few months just getting the showtime tv guide to work with tivo.
